Art on the Web Presentation

On Tuesday, April 22 SWAA members came out to learn more about marketing their work on the internet.  

Paul Constable and Holly Edwards-Grove shared their expertise with us.

Paul Constable has extensive experience marketing art on the web through his website: Artists in Canada at Artists in Canada.com

Paul graduated from the Alberta College of Art & Design in 1976 and has a long list of accomplishments. Visit his website to find out more: PaulConstable.com at PaulConstable.com

Holly Edwards-Grove graduated from the University of Regina with a Bachelor of Fine Arts (B.F.A.), Drawing. She has continued her education to obtain her Advanced Web Design CertificateWeb Page, Digital/Multimedia and Information Resources Design from the Online School of Design.

Holly sells her custom made cake toppers primarily using Etsy.

SWAA at Hues Art Supply

Paul Trottier treated us to an introductory tour of his new art supply store on March 25:
Hues Art Supply Ltd.
1818 Lorne Avenue, Saskatoon - the corner of Taylor and Lorne

Paul opened his store in January 2014, and is still determining the needs of artists in this area.  Drop in to let him know what your art specialty is - if he doesn't already stock what you require he will be happy to order it in.  The store is open during the day from Tuesday - Saturday.  Closed Sunday & Monday.
